
Rural Fiction Magazine was established to explore the beauty and drama of rural America.
Rural Fiction Magazine seeks primarily mainstream/literary stories and poetry set in the rural US. Although we may take occasional forays into other genres (such as horror, fantasy, science fiction, etc.), all works we publish will be related in some fashion to rural America. Therefore, the mainstream and literary genres seem most suitable for our mission.
We intend to start out by publishing a few stories either weekly or monthly, depending on the amount of submissions we receive. We are capping the word limit at 5,000. All submissions must be in standard manuscript format (you can find out the details of this on Google). Response time may range from a day to a month, but will most likely be within a week.
